31 #ifndef __MEM_RUBY_NETWORK_GARNET2_0_ROUTINGUNIT_HH__
32 #define __MEM_RUBY_NETWORK_GARNET2_0_ROUTINGUNIT_HH__
33
34 #include "mem/ruby/common/Consumer.hh"
35 #include "mem/ruby/common/NetDest.hh"
36 #include "mem/ruby/network/garnet2.0/CommonTypes.hh"
37 #include "mem/ruby/network/garnet2.0/GarnetNetwork.hh"
38 #include "mem/ruby/network/garnet2.0/flit.hh"
39
40 class InputUnit;
41 class Router;
42
43 class RoutingUnit
44 {
45 public:
46 RoutingUnit(Router *router);
47 int outportCompute(RouteInfo route,
48 int inport,
49 PortDirection inport_dirn);
50
51 // Topology-agnostic Routing Table based routing (default)
52 void addRoute(std::vector<NetDest>& routing_table_entry);
53 void addWeight(int link_weight);
54
55 // get output port from routing table
56 int lookupRoutingTable(int vnet, NetDest net_dest);
57
58 // Topology-specific direction based routing
59 void addInDirection(PortDirection inport_dirn, int inport);
60 void addOutDirection(PortDirection outport_dirn, int outport);
61
62 // Routing for Mesh
63 int outportComputeXY(RouteInfo route,
64 int inport,
65 PortDirection inport_dirn);
66
67 // Custom Routing Algorithm using Port Directions
68 int outportComputeCustom(RouteInfo route,
69 int inport,
70 PortDirection inport_dirn);
71
72 // Returns true if vnet is present in the vector
73 // of vnets or if the vector supports all vnets.
74 bool supportsVnet(int vnet, std::vector<int> sVnets);
75
76
77 private:
78 Router *m_router;
79
80 // Routing Table
81 std::vector<std::vector<NetDest>> m_routing_table;
82 std::vector<int> m_weight_table;
83
84 // Inport and Outport direction to idx maps
85 std::map<PortDirection, int> m_inports_dirn2idx;
86 std::map<int, PortDirection> m_inports_idx2dirn;
87 std::map<int, PortDirection> m_outports_idx2dirn;
88 std::map<PortDirection, int> m_outports_dirn2idx;
89 };
90
91 #endif // __MEM_RUBY_NETWORK_GARNET2_0_ROUTINGUNIT_HH__
